Landscape Installation Project Manager

BraveView has been engaged by a Commercial Landscape company in the Tampa, FL market to recruit and hire a Project Manager to join their growing landscape construction team.

Reporting to the GM of Construction, the Project Manager will coordinate with multiple Superintendents,

crews, and project operations personnel to plan and complete landscape installation jobs ranging from $50K to $1M+.

The ideal candidate should be career oriented, self-motivated and will thrive in a fast-paced, entrepreneurial environment where taking care of your team members and your customers is always top priority.

This position will have the opportunity to shape the processes of the growth-oriented culture via process development, employee training, and job planning through daily dashboards and client relationships.

Responsibilities :

Leading the day-to-day execution of landscape installation projects with Superintendents to include : scheduling of materials, equipment, and subcontractor coordination;

change order administration and management; document control; RFI's, etc.

  • Managing RFI's, Change Orders, Submittals, 811 Calls, Identify Qualified Vendors, Manage Plan Grid,
  • Involved with managing the COR process by assisting with scope review, pricing, contract evaluation, etc.
  • Ensuring optimal productivity and adherence to project timeline and budget through cost management, revenue optimization, and accurate and timely billing.
  • Establish Budgets and conduct monthly reporting duties.
  • Manage permitting and general document management.
  • Manage Punch list and Closeout to make sure the client is satisfied and the company complied fully with contractual obligations.
  • Communicating effectively and proactively with both internal team members and external contacts.
  • Building and maintaining professional relationships with developers, contractors, architects, and property managers, etc.

Constant communication with clients as the main point of contact.

  • Will be a positive, trustworthy first-line representative of the company to our clients.
  • Ensuring product and service standards through strict quality control by conducting thorough reviews and inspections of completed work.
  • Operating with high professional and ethical standards with an emphasis on compliance and safety.
  • Assisting in technology implementation to improve processes and enhance data reporting.
  • Additional tasks as assigned.

Requirements :

  • Bachelor's degree in Construction Management, Horticulture, or related field is preferred
  • Experience with the paperwork required for construction projects as a project leader / manager, project engineer, project coordinator, or superintendent.
  • Strong organizational skills that allow you to be efficient and structured with a commitment to accuracy, deadlines, and performance
  • Proficiency in the use of the Microsoft Office Suite and other standard office technologies and tools
  • Spanish language proficiency a plus but not required
